> We have JBoss as the application server & Tomcat as the web server
> in our production & developmental setup which is on Red Hat Linux
> 5.X. We have tomcat 6.X. My query is that if I need to restart
> tomcat, do I need to restart JBoss & Tomcat both or just restarting
> Tomcat would be enough. I am asking this query because I had killed
> the tomcat process using kill -9 and while restarting tomcat it was
> not starting but when I killed JBoss & tomcat and then restarted,
> Tomcat was up.
> 
> I hope my query is clear whether Tomcat is dependent on JBoss.

I'm fairly sure that there is only a single JVM for JBoss/Tomcat. If
you killed one, you've killed the other.
